Sirna-027 for AMD is officially dead.

Sirna what? Sirna-027 was the much ballyhooed lead drug from Sirna Therapeutics, which the company licensed to AGN in 2005: #msg-7926760. (MRK acquired Sirna in 2006: #msg-14401261.)

Sirna-027 produced good phase-1 results; the biggest problem may have been that the duration of the clinical effect was too short, as can be seen from the table in #msg-12579143.

I’ve been pretty sure that this program was dead for quite some time because AGN never talked about it. Now, it’s 100% — read the last paragraph of this Reuters newswire:

With the demise of Sirna-027, OPK (#msg-21124315, #msg-25128755) and PFE (#msg-13574577) are, to my knowledge, the only companies still testing RNAi in the clinic as a treatment for AMD. MRK at one time had a JV with ALNY to develop an AMD drug, but the collaboration made no progress and was dissolved in 2006.
